Estes Forwarding Worldwide (EFW) is a leading domestic and international freight forwarder in the United States, providing customized logistics and warehousing solutions for clients around the world and across all industries via air, ground, and ocean freight. A subsidiary of Estes Express Lines, EFW is uniquely backed by Estes Express Lines’ extensive line haul network, offering clients a hybrid transportation network.

About the role

The Manager, Global Solutions (GSM) is accountable for developing new business and securing incremental revenue and market share through promotion and sales of all services and products to target and establish accounts.
